docs(rfc): RFC-010 — restructure the CLI around explicit planes (#214)
The CLI silently spans three planes (data / storage-maintenance / control)
and forces the operator to name a graph differently per plane: the graph
you query as `--server prod --graph knowledge` you must maintain as
`s3://bucket/knowledge.omni`. Plane restrictions (graphs list is
server-only, optimize is storage-only) are accidental — discovered by
hitting a cryptic error, not declared.

RFC-010 proposes: one graph-addressing model across every verb, a declared
per-subcommand capability surface (expanding RFC-009 Phase 4), and
plane-grouped --help. Storage maintenance stays off the wire deliberately
(no HTTP routes for optimize/cleanup/repair). CLI-internal only — no
engine, server, or wire change.

Incorporates the Codex review thread (kept verbatim with per-point
Resolution notes): sharpened resolver authority rule (operator/legacy
target must be direct storage; cluster-managed graphs via explicit
--cluster --graph), per-subcommand capability table (schema plan vs
show/apply, queries validate vs list, session/tooling classified), graphs
list aligned to RFC-009's both-later target, init promoted to an explicit
cluster-apply signpost, and a Test plan that extends the existing CLI
suites and pins the new wrong-plane error strings.

Developer Docs

Audience: contributors, maintainers, and coding agents

This is the contributor-facing entry point. These docs explain architecture, invariants, implementation contracts, test ownership, and upstream Lance constraints. User-facing behavior should still be documented through docs/user/index.md and the relevant public reference docs.

Public contribution RFC track rfcs/

The docs/rfcs/ track is the public, externally-authorable RFC process. The maintainer/internal RFCs below (rfc-00N-*.md) are a separate, team-owned track; don't conflate the two.

Boundary

Developer docs may mention implementation details, stale gaps, upstream Lance blockers, and review rules. User docs should not require that context unless the detail changes the public contract.
